Pulwama attack: India withdraws 'Most Favoured Nation' status to Pakistan
In international trade, MFN treatment is synonymous with non-discriminatory trade policy as it ensures equal trading among all WTO member nations rather than exclusive trading privileges.

India-Pakistan trade has potential to touch $37 billion, says World Bank report
Items on the Indian sensitive list can be imported at the most-favoured-nation tariffs from any SAFTA country, including Pakistan, because India accorded Pakistan the status in 1996, soon after the accession of the two countries to the World Trade Organisation (WTO)
